Report: Raiders among teams pursuing Eric Weddle

Steve Mitchell / USA TODAY Sports

The Oakland Raiders made a big splash in free agency, signing Kelechi Osemele, Bruce Irvin, and Sean Smith, and they're apparently not done yet.

The Raiders are interested in former San Diego Chargers safety Eric Weddle, multiple sources have told Scott Bair of CSNBayArea.com, with one saying the team has reached out to his representatives in the hopes of convincing him to sign.

The Raiders are among at least four teams pursuing Weddle at the moment, reports Kevin Acee of the San Diego Union-Tribune.

Weddle, however, isn't rushing the decision.

"Patience," his agent, David Canter, wrote Thursday on Twitter. "Have to make the right decision. We have lots to process."

Smith, who's also represented by Canter, is doing his part to try to convince Weddle to join him in Oakland.

"I was talking to him before I even came up here," Smith told Bair. "Look, if we were to add Eric Weddle, it would just be so special. But regardless of who we add, I know (assistant defensive backs coach Rod Woodson) and (secondary coach Marcus Robertson) are going to make it work in the back-end. But Eric Weddle is definitely a special player and I think if we can get him, we'll be alright."
